Hi Jim,

Prior to calling the SHOW() Method of the VFP Form, you can set the Caption to whatever you want. That is why quite a while ago, that I created the ReportFormObject Method to return an object reference to the FORM instantiated by the report engine so you can then manipulate properties on the Form and the Minds Eye Report Engine ActiveX control prior to displaying the Form.

There is also a CREPORTPREVIEWFORMCAPTION Property of the MindsEyeReportEngine that you can set as well that will override the Default Caption that I set it to only if the CREPORTPREVIEWFORMCAPTION Property is empty. You would want to set this if the LINSTANTPREVIEW Property is set to TRUE because that Property tells the Report Engine to instantly display the Report Engine Form while processing the report so you don't have to wait for the Report to finish before it is displayed.
SET CLASSLIBRARY TO MindsEyeReportEngine
oReportEngine = CREATEOBJECT('MindsEyeReportEngine')
oReportEngine.cReportPreviewFormCaption = 'My Favorite Caption'

oRPTForm = oReportEngine.ReportFormObject('SomeReport.FRX')
oRPTForm.Caption = 'My Favorite Caption'
oRPTForm.Show()
